Main Bus Stations in Hyderabad

MGBS (Mahatma Gandhi Bus Station)

Situated near the city center in Hyderabad, MGBS is easily accessible and close to landmarks like the Nampally Railway Station and Public Gardens.

Main Bus Stations in Sringeri

Sringeri Bus Station

Located in the heart of Sringeri, this station is close to the famous Sharada Peetham and other local attractions.

Travel Tips

  • ⛰ Plan Around Scenic Viewpoints

    The bus route from Hyderabad to Sringeri showcases stunning landscapes, especially as you approach the Western Ghats. Plan your trip during daylight hours to enjoy beautiful views of hills and coffee plantations. The stretch near Kudremukh is particularly breathtaking.

  • 📍 Pack Local Snacks

    Pack some local snacks to savor along the way. Taste the famous 'Bajji' (fried chili) or 'Chakli' (fried snack) which you can find in many eateries in Hyderabad. This adds a touch of local flavor to your journey.

  • 🚍 Stay Informed About Festivals

    Check if any local festivals are happening in Sringeri or along the route, such as the annual 'Sharadamba Jayanti.' Travel can get busier during these times, so booking your tickets in advance is a good idea.

FAQ

Several bus operators service the Hyderabad to Sringeri route, including KSRTC and private operators like VRL and SRS. It's advisable to check their schedules and book tickets in advance.
Yes, there are direct buses available, but some services may require a transfer or stopover, typically at major hubs like Shimoga. Confirm your bus schedule when booking.
The journey usually takes about 12 to 14 hours depending on traffic and the specific service. Plan accordingly and consider night travel for a more restful journey.
Most bus services allow a luggage limit of around 25 kg per passenger, but it's best to check the specific policies of the bus operator you choose to ensure compliance.
Buses on this route often come equipped with reclining seats, air-conditioning, and sometimes onboard refreshments. Luxury services may also offer entertainment systems and charging ports.
